  • Patent number: 5549014
    Abstract: A workcenter comprises a track (14) having a carriage (24) moveable along the track by a screw (32) rotated by a motor (30). The carriage has a bore (42) surrounding the screw. Two sleeve members (160) are received in the bore at either end thereof and surround said screw. The sleeve members are segmented and have threads for engagement with the screw. The sleeve members are pressed radially into engagement with the screw by a spring ring (198). The sleeve members are constructed from deformable plastics material and are screwed onto the screw against the opposite shoulders (163) around the bore in the carriage sufficient to deform the threads so as to take up axial freedom of movement between the carriage and screw. This arrangement allows an inexpensive rolled steel screw having inherent inaccuracies to be employed without loss of positional accuracy.

  • Patent number: 5549019
    Abstract: An apparatus for balancing the grinding wheel (2) of a grinding machine, comprising an assembly coupled to and rotating with the wheel and including masses (24, 26) the position of which is adjustable and electrical motors (28, 30) to control adjusting movements of the masses. The electrical connection between the motors and a survey and processing unit (16) including a power source (40) is provided by slip rings (48) and brushes (54). The brushes are fixed to a movable support (52). A spring (58) acts on the movable support to space the brushes apart from the slip rings. An actuator including, for example, electromagnets (60) acts on the movable support to perform the contact between the brushes and the corresponding slip rings.

  • Patent number: 5549023
    Abstract: A disc brake lathe for machining a brake disc on a vehicle without removing the brake disc from the vehicle but only the wheel and other parts of the brake mechanism. The disc brake lathe comprises a power drive unit for rotating a brake disc on the vehicle and a lathe head having at least one cutting tool for machining a brake disc while the brake disc on the vehicle is rotated by the power drive unit. The lathe head is adapted to be mounted on the vehicle for machining a brake disc on the vehicle and includes a motor for power feeding of the at least one cutting tool during machining. The vibration of the lathe head during machining, which causes rough surface finish on the machined brake discs, is avoided or reduced by the provision of a vibration dampener which is attached to the lathe head for absorbing energy of vibration.

  • Patent number: 5549034
    Abstract: Metallic piston, wrist pin and connecting rod which normally do not fit together can be joined with one selected component being heated to effect the expansion thereof while another selected component is chilled to effect its contraction. With the heat differentials effecting relative size change the components can be loosely put together in a preassembly. The components in the loose preassembly are then returned to ambient temperature and to specification size whereby a central journal of the wrist pin is trapped between the piston pin bosses in one embodiment and the connecting rod is trapped by the shoulders of a reduced diameter pin journal in a second embodiment to form permanent piston, connecting rod and wrist pin assemblies.

  • Patent number: 5549038
    Abstract: A modulated steam cooker in which food to be cooked is received in an oven chamber having an access door associated with a door switch, steam being fed directly into the oven by a steam generator having an electric heater immersed in a pool of water. The heater is connected through the door switch to a power source whereby the generator is powered only when the door is shut. The pressure of steam draining from the oven is sensed by a pressure-responsive switch interposed between the heater and the power source, the pressure switch intermittently interrupting the power supplied to the heater only when the sensed pressure exceeds a predetermined level somewhat above atmospheric pressure, thereby modulating the generation of steam supplied to the oven as a function of the quantity and temperature of food therein to effect efficient cooking of the food. Mounted on the steam generator is a spray head supplied with water only when the door is opened.

  • Patent number: 5549059
    Abstract: Paper mill sludge or similar organic sludges with a high ash content are converted by burning the sludge in a cyclone furnace along with another source of fuel. The heat content of the sludge is recovered and the ash content of the sludge is converted to a glassy slag. A flux, such as limestone, may be added to the sludge before introduction into the cyclone furnace. The slag is useful as a construction material, an abrasive, for roofing products, or for other purposes.
